What’s the average salary for a person in Honduras?

A person working in Honduras typically earns around 49,600 HNL per month. Salaries range from 6,710 HNL (lowest average) to 220,000 HNL (highest average, actual maximum salary is higher). This is the average monthly salary including housing, transport, and other benefits. Salaries vary drastically between different careers.

What’s the average salary per hour in Denmark?

There is no official minimum salary in Copenhagen and in Denmark as a whole. However, as of 2020 most minimum wages in the country hover around 110 DKK per hour (roughly 16 .60 US dollars). The average working week in Denmark is of 37 hours.
